"Biography" and Contact:Composer, Music Producer, Songwriter, and Multi-Instrumentalist Timo Chen began studying piano at the age of 5 at the Colburn School of Performing Arts. Young Timo didn't deal with reading music and practicing, but his natural affinity for improvisation and melody more than made up for his impatience and good looks. He went on to study at the Oberlin Conservatory of Music and upon graduation, he paid off his student loans by playing in top-40 bands across Asia where he could take time off to study Balinese Gamelan, Tai-Ji Quan, Peking Opera, and shop for fake brand-name clothing and bootlegged media. He returned to the states in the late 90s and soon after began working with legendary producer David Tickle (Four non-blondes, Blondie, Split-Enz). Frustrated by the bands he was working with, he was given the opportunity to work with academy-award winning film maker Chris Tashima to do music for his short film, “Day of Independence.” Little by little, his career finally started to take off (with the stress on “little”).
